All Rights Reserved #include "MsDeformAttn/ms_deform_attn.h" namespace groundingdino { #ifdef WITH_CUDA extern int get_cudart_version(); #endif std::string get_cuda_version() { #ifdef WITH_CUDA std::ostringstream oss; // copied from // https://github.com/pytorch/pytorch/blob/master/aten/src/ATen/cuda/detail/CUDAHooks.cpp#L231 auto printCudaStyleVersion = [&](int v) { oss << (v / 1000) << "." << (v / 10 % 100); if (v % 10 != 0) { oss << "." << (v % 10); } }; printCudaStyleVersion(get_cudart_version()); return oss.str(); #else return std::string("not available"); #endif } // similar to // https://github.com/pytorch/pytorch/blob/master/aten/src/ATen/Version.cpp std::string get_compiler_version() { std::ostringstream ss; #if defined(__GNUC__) #ifndef __clang__ { ss << "GCC " << __GNUC__ << "." << __GNUC_MINOR__; } #endif #endif #if defined(__clang_major__) { ss << "clang " << __clang_major__ << "." << __clang_minor__ << "." << __clang_patchlevel__; } #endif #if defined(_MSC_VER) { ss << "MSVC " << _MSC_FULL_VER; } #endif return ss.str(); } PYBIND11_MODULE(TORCH_EXTENSION_NAME, m) { m.def("ms_deform_attn_forward", &ms_deform_attn_forward, "ms_deform_attn_forward"); m.def("ms_deform_attn_backward", &ms_deform_attn_backward, "ms_deform_attn_backward"); } } // namespace groundingdino
